logo

JobNob

Your Career. Our Passion.

Senior Backend Engineer


Outsized


Location

Delhi | India


Job description

Who are we? High quality talent and large enterprises are moving towards a more flexible model of work that benefits both sides. By being flexible and project based, professional freelancers are able to work on interesting projects, gain valuable skills, and produce more outcomes, vs. being in traditional roles. Enterprises are also able to move much faster by getting the right skills, at the right time, while reducing risk and increasing the speed and quality of project outcomes. The world is changing, and Outsized is playing a big part. Outsized is a curated talent marketplace that helps large enterprises, in growth markets, find professional freelancers on-demand. We are present in Southeast Asia, South Africa, India and the Middle East. We have a super strong team of founders that have experience in marketplace building, growth markets, technology, and financial services. Our CPO, Azeem, leads the entire product and engineering team and has worked for and built amazing products at companies like Housing.com, Qure.ai and ShopX. This one’s going to be bigger and better! You will be joining a team that has, on a bootstrap budget, built a strong cash-flow generating business with over 25,000 quality assured professional freelancers on the platform, and over 100 global enterprises including some of the biggest global consulting firms and financial services companies out there (wish we could name them, but we can’t!) But now, we are ready to scale into the big leagues with an amazing investor that is backing our Series A. And that is where YOU come in. Our business is growing rapidly and there are so many opportunities to do cool things with us.

Who are you!? We value those with an entrepreneurial spirit and those who bring experience from established organizations. You ought to be comfortable in dealing with lots of moving pieces. You must have excellent attention to detail; and you should be flexible and comfortable to learn new technologies and systems.

Job Summary We're actively seeking a proficient and seasoned

Senior Backend Engineer (SDE3)

to strengthen our team. In this pivotal role, you'll play a crucial part in developing and delivering high-quality software solutions. The ideal candidate possesses expertise in serverless technologies, with hands-on experience in backend technologies such as server-side programming, databases, and cloud platforms like AWS. Proficiency in Node.js, along with experience in Elasticsearch and event-driven architectures, is preferred. A solid foundation in computer science and a minimum of 6 years' experience are essential, as is expertise in designing robust data structures and creating optimized solution architectures.

Responsibilities Collaborate with cross-functional teams to gather requirements, design solutions, and deliver high-quality software products. Implement and optimize serverless architectures on AWS Lambda for efficient resource utilization and cost-effectiveness. Architect event-driven systems and implement event-driven microservices using technologies like AWS Event-Bridge or Apache Kafka. Optimize data structures and algorithms for improved efficiency and scalability of backend systems. Utilize Elasticsearch for efficient indexing, searching, and analysis of large datasets. Ensure the reliability, availability, and performance of backend services by implementing best practices in coding, testing, and monitoring. Troubleshoot and debug issues in production environments, ensuring timely resolution and minimal disruption. Mentor junior team members, conduct code reviews, and contribute to the continuous improvement of development processes and standards. Stay updated on emerging technologies, tools, and best practices in backend development, cloud computing, and serverless architectures.

Qualifications Bachelor's degree in Computer Science or a related field : A solid foundation in computer science principles is essential for this role. Minimum of 6 years of experience : Candidates should have extensive experience in backend development, including server-side programming, databases, and cloud platforms like AWS. Expertise in backend technologies : Proficiency in Node.js, Python, or similar languages is required for designing, developing, and maintaining scalable backend services. Experience with serverless architectures : Candidates should have hands-on experience implementing and optimizing serverless architectures on platforms like AWS Lambda. Familiarity with Elastic-Search : Experience using Elastic-Search for indexing, searching, and analyzing large datasets is preferred. Understanding of event-driven architectures : Candidates should have experience architecting event-driven systems and implementing event-driven microservices using technologies like AWS Event-Bridge or Apache Kafka. Strong problem-solving skills : The ability to troubleshoot and debug issues in production environments is crucial for ensuring the reliability and availability of backend services. Knowledge of data structures and algorithms : Candidates should have expertise in designing and optimizing data structures and algorithms for improved efficiency and scalability. Excellent communication and collaboration skills : The ability to work effectively in cross-functional teams and communicate technical concepts to non-technical stakeholders is essential. Continuous learning mindset : Candidates should be proactive in staying updated on emerging technologies, tools, and best practices in backend development, cloud computing, and serverless architectures.

Salary Range The salary range for this position is competitive and based on experience and qualifications.


Job tags



Salary

All rights reserved